We help you see how products truly perform in consumers’ everyday environments, uncovering insights that can predict real market success. Through in-home testing, we capture the full experience: from first impressions and ease of use to how it fits into routines, uncovers unexpected benefits or barriers, and compares to what they’re using now. This big-picture view helps you fine-tune products before launch to meet—and exceed—consumer expectations. For more controlled insights, Central Location Testing (CLT) lets consumers evaluate products, packaging, ads, or concepts in a consistent, in-person setting. By minimizing outside variables, CLT delivers fast, reliable feedback – perfect for product testing, sensory evaluations, and head-to-head comparisons.

Our client, operating within the highly competitive personal grooming category, initiated a consumer acceptance test for three new product prototypes. The primary objectives were to determine if a prototype could achieve consumer acceptance by performing at parity or better than the main competitor on overall preference and key performance claims, and also improving upon their current product offering, which needed enhancement in areas related to skin protection.
A sequential monadic home usage test (HUT) was conducted involving five products: Our client’s current product, the main competitive product and three new prototypes. The results delivered a decisive outcome. One prototype clearly surpassed both the current product and the competitive benchmark on overall preference and the majority of tested claims. This suggested a viable path for product improvement and market leadership.
By focusing development on core experiential metrics, our client could leapfrog the competition. Key potential enhancements included delivering a significantly better user experience during application and validating stronger product results that support new, superior claims. Recommendations were to leverage the winning prototype to enhance overall performance across all relevant consumer touchpoints.
The key activation strategy involved moving forward with the winning prototype while focusing development efforts on addressing the pain points reported by users, thereby optimizing the user experience and ensuring long-term product success before commercial launch.
